【什么是IFRAME】IFRAME 是 HTML 中一个常用的标签,全称为 Inline Frame,用于在网页中嵌入其他网页或资源。通过 IFRAME,开发者可以将外部内容直接显示在当前页面中,而无需用户跳转到其他页面。IFRAME 在网页设计、广告嵌入、数据展示等方面有广泛应用。
IFRAME 是一种 HTML 元素,允许在网页中嵌入另一个网页或资源。它能够独立加载内容,并与主页面保持分离。使用 IFRAME 可以提升用户体验,减少页面刷新,但同时也可能带来安全性和性能方面的挑战。以下是关于 IFRAME 的关键信息总结。
IFRAME 简介与特点
项目 | 内容 |
全称 | Inline Frame |
功能 | 嵌入外部网页或资源 |
语法 | `<iframe src="URL" ...></iframe>` |
属性 | src(必需)、width、height、frameborder、allow、allowfullscreen 等 |
用途 | 广告嵌入、地图显示、视频播放、跨域内容展示等 |
优点 | 用户无需跳转页面,提高体验;可独立加载内容 |
缺点 | 可能影响 SEO;安全性较低(如 XSS 攻击);加载速度慢 |
兼容性 | 支持主流浏览器(Chrome、Firefox、Edge、Safari 等) |
使用示例:
```html
<iframe src="https://www.example.com" width="600" height="400" frameborder="0"></iframe>
```
这段代码会在当前页面中显示 `example.com` 的内容,宽度为 600 像素,高度为 400 像素。
注意事项:
- 安全性:避免使用不受信任的源,防止恶意脚本注入。
- SEO 影响:搜索引擎可能无法有效抓取 IFRAME 中的内容。
- 性能:过多使用 IFRAME 可能导致页面加载缓慢。
总结:
IFRAME 是一种实用的 HTML 技术,适合需要嵌入外部内容的场景。合理使用它可以增强网页功能和用户体验,但也需注意其潜在的问题。在实际开发中,应结合项目需求,权衡利弊后再决定是否采用 IFRAME。